This XpressRead Cram Edition of The Moving Finger pairs the complete original text with carefully prepared study materials, designed for deeper engagement with this classic.

"The Moving Finger" offers a captivating collection of short stories by pioneering Australian author Mary Gaunt. Delve into the complexities of colonial life in Australia through the eyes of a woman navigating a rapidly changing world. Gaunt's insightful narratives explore themes of cultural identity, the challenges faced by women, and the nuances of human relationships within the unique landscape of Australia. These stories, reflecting the author's keen observations and literary talent, provide a window into a bygone era. Experience the enduring power of Gaunt's storytelling as she masterfully captures the spirit of a nation in its formative years. This meticulously prepared print edition preserves the original text, allowing readers to fully appreciate the historical and literary significance of Gaunt's work. Perfect for those interested in Australian literature, short stories, and the voices of women writers.
